Max Muhleman: The Unsung Architect Behind Hendrick Motorsports and Sports Marketing Innovation

 The NASCAR and broader sports world is mourning the loss of Max Muhleman, a visionary marketer whose behind-the-scenes contributions played a pivotal role in shaping modern sports franchises, including the powerhouse that is Hendrick Motorsports (HMS). While Muhleman may not have been a household name on the NASCAR circuit, his influence on the sport—and professional sports at large—was monumental.


The Man Behind Hendrick’s NASCAR Dream

When Rick Hendrick embarked on his journey to build what would become a NASCAR dynasty, it was Muhleman who stood by his side, offering strategic insight and unwavering support. Muhleman’s ability to think beyond the racetrack helped Hendrick Motorsports grow into one of the most successful organizations in motorsports history, with 312 race wins and 14 championships to its name.

In a heartfelt tribute, Hendrick credited Muhleman as a foundational figure in HMS’s creation. Sharing an iconic photo of Muhleman from the team’s inaugural All-Star Racing announcement in 1984, Hendrick wrote:
“Rick has always said Hendrick Motorsports would not have happened without Max Muhleman, who approached him about starting a NASCAR team more than 40 years ago.”


Jeff Gordon’s Career Catalyst

Muhleman’s impact wasn’t confined to HMS as an entity—it extended to its drivers, most notably Jeff Gordon, a seven-time NASCAR champion. In 2000, Muhleman facilitated a partnership between Gordon and International Management Group (IMG), placing Gordon alongside legends like Arnold Palmer, Derek Jeter, and Peyton Manning. This move solidified Gordon’s off-track legacy, establishing him as a mainstream figure with enduring brand partnerships.

Muhleman had a unique understanding of Gordon’s star power, saying:
“Jeff is a very 21st-century personality because he appeals to younger people and his business is about speed. It ties into the age of technology—the faster world we now live in.”


A Legacy Beyond NASCAR

Muhleman’s contributions to sports extend far beyond NASCAR. In the NFL, he played a crucial role in securing expansion teams for the Carolina Panthers and the Charlotte Hornets. His most notable innovation was the creation of the Permanent Seat License (PSL), a groundbreaking concept that allowed fans to secure the right to buy season tickets for a one-time fee. The revenues from PSLs directly funded the construction of iconic venues like the Bank of America Stadium, home to the Panthers.

Panthers founder Jerry Richardson and other key figures credited Muhleman as a game-changer:
“Max wasn’t out front—he preferred to be in the background—but he was as valuable as anybody in the process of getting a team.”


A Lasting Legacy

Muhleman’s passing has drawn tributes from NASCAR and NFL leaders alike, celebrating his profound influence on the sports industry. His innovative spirit, ability to recognize talent, and knack for creating groundbreaking marketing concepts have left an indelible mark.

For NASCAR fans, Muhleman’s contributions are inseparable from the legacy of Hendrick Motorsports and its drivers. For NFL enthusiasts, his work is a reminder that the success of a franchise often begins with the creativity and determination of visionaries like Muhleman.

As Jeff Gordon, Rick Hendrick, and others continue to honor his memory, Muhleman’s legacy stands as a testament to how far-reaching the impact of a single individual can be in shaping the world of sports. He was a behind-the-scenes giant who turned dreams into dynasties, forever altering the landscape of American sports.
